Jó 31

1 "I have made a covenant with my eyes;

Why then should I look upon a (Matt. 5:28)young woman?

2 For what is the Job 20:29allotment of God from above,

And the inheritance of the Almighty from on high?

3 Is it not destruction for the wicked,

And disaster for the workers of iniquity?

4 (2 Chr. 16:9); Job 24:23; 28:24; 34:21; 36:7; (Prov. 5:21; 15:3; Jer. 32:19)Does He not see my ways,

And count all my steps?

5 "If I have walked with falsehood,

Or if my foot has hastened to deceit,

6 Let me be weighed on honest scales,

That God may know my Job 23:10; 27:5, 6integrity.

7 If my step has turned from the way,

Or Num. 15:39; (Eccl. 11:9); Ezek. 6:9; (Matt. 5:29)my heart walked after my eyes,

Or if any spot adheres to my hands,

8 ThenLev. 26:16; Deut. 28:30, 38; Job 20:18; Mic. 6:15let me sow, and another eat;

Yes, let my harvest be rooted out.

9 "If my heart has been enticed by a woman,

Or if I have lurked at my neighbor’s door,

10 Then let my wife grind for Deut. 28:30; 2 Sam. 12:11; Jer. 8:10another,

And let others bow down over her.

11 For that wouldbe wickedness;

Yes, Gen. 38:24; (Lev. 20:10; Deut. 22:22); Job 31:28it wouldbe iniquity deservingof judgment.

12 For that wouldbe a fire that consumes to destruction,

And would root out all my increase.

13 "If I have (Deut. 24:14, 15)despised the cause of my male or female servant

When they complained against me,

14 What then shall I do when (Ps. 44:21)God rises up?

When He punishes, how shall I answer Him?

15 Job 34:19; Prov. 14:31; 22:2; (Mal. 2:10)Did not He who made me in the womb make them?

Did not the same One fashion us in the womb?

16 "If I have kept the poor from their desire,

Or caused the eyes of the widow to Job 29:12fail,

17 Or eaten my morsel by myself,

So that the fatherless could not eat of it

18 (But from my youth I reared him as a father,

And from my mother’s womb I guided thewidow);

19 If I have seen anyone perish for lack of clothing,

Or any poor man without covering;

20 If his heart has not (Deut. 24:13)blessed me,

And if he was not warmed with the fleece of my sheep;

21 If I have raised my hand Job 22:9against the fatherless,

When I saw I had help in the gate;

22 Then let my arm fall from my shoulder,

Let my arm be torn from the socket.

23 For Is. 13:6destruction from God is a terror to me,

And because of His magnificence I cannot endure.

24 "If(Matt. 6:19, 20; Mark 10:23–25) I have made gold my hope,

Or said to fine gold, Youare my confidence;

25 Job 1:3, 10; Ps. 62:10If I have rejoiced because my wealth was great,

And because my hand had gained much;

26 (Deut. 4:19; 17:3); Ezek. 8:16If I have observed the sun when it shines,

Or the moon moving in brightness,

27 So that my heart has been secretly enticed,

And my mouth has kissed my hand;

28 This also wouldbe an iniquity deservingof judgment,

For I would have denied God whois above.

29 "If(Prov. 17:5; 24:17); Obad. 12 I have rejoiced at the destruction of him who hated me,

Or lifted myself up when evil found him

30 (Matt. 5:44)(Indeed I have not allowed my mouth to sin

By asking for a curse on his soul);

31 If the men of my tent have not said,

Who is there that has not been satisfied with his meat?

32 Gen. 19:2, 3(But no sojourner had to lodge in the street,

For I have opened my doors to the traveler);

33 If I have covered my transgressions Gen. 3:10; (Prov. 28:13)as Adam,

By hiding my iniquity in my bosom,

34 Because I feared the great Ex. 23:2multitude,

And dreaded the contempt of families,

So that I kept silence

And did not go out of the door

35 Job 19:7; 30:20, 24, 28Oh, that I had one to hear me!

Here is my mark.

Oh, Job 13:22, 24; 33:10that the Almighty would answer me,

That my Prosecutor had written a book!

36 Surely I would carry it on my shoulder,

And bind it on me like a crown;

37 I would declare to Him the number of my steps;

Like a prince I would approach Him.

38 "If my land cries out against me,

And its furrows weep together;

39 If Job 24:6, 10–12; (James 5:4)I have eaten its fruit without money,

Or 1 Kin. 21:19caused its owners to lose their lives;

40 Then let Gen. 3:18thistles grow instead of wheat,

And weeds instead of barley."

The words of Job are ended.
